East Providence Robbery: One Suspect In Custody

Taunton, Mass., police have one suspect in custody, Lt. Raymond Blinn confirmed Friday. Details are coming later today.

EAST PROVIDENCE, RI — Police have collared one of the two suspects connected to Saturday's robbery and stabbing at Towne Wine & Liquor, Lt. Raymond Blinn confirmed on Friday. The Taunton, Mass., police arrested him Thursday night. The other suspect is still at large.

Taunton and Raynham, Mass., police and Pawtucket and East Providence have been working together to find the two suspects who are implicated in robberies in the four towns. On Saturday, they allegedly robbed a Pawtucket store and then held up the store in East Providence. During that incident, a customer, a 68-year-old man, was stabbed.

Blinn said police will release more information later today.
